A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

In the polishing agent preparation process, the existing technology requires additional screening and grinding steps to deal with agglomerated materials, which prolongs the stirring time and causes inconvenience in use.

Method used

A stirring device was designed, which includes a tank, a stirring shaft, a motor and a grinding sleeve located above the stirring chamber. The stirring shaft drives the blade to rotate to grind the bulk material, and during the stirring process, the material is crushed into powder and enters the stirring chamber to be fully mixed with the polishing agent.

Benefits of technology

The high-efficiency grinding of agglomerated materials during the stirring process is achieved, the process flow is simplified, and the mixing efficiency and production efficiency of the polishing agent are improved.

Abstract

The utility model relates to a stirring device for preparing a polishing agent, which comprises a tank body, a cover body, a stirring shaft rotatably arranged in the tank body and a motor, the motor is linked with the stirring shaft, the stirring shaft and the tank body extend up and down in the length direction, a stirring cavity is arranged in the tank body, the stirring device further comprises a grinding sleeve, and the grinding sleeve comprises a grinding cavity. A splash-proof cover is detachably installed on the grinding sleeve, the stirring shaft comprises a stirring section and a grinding section where the grinding sleeve is inserted, a stirring paddle is fixedly installed on the stirring section, a blade is fixedly installed on the grinding section and located in the grinding sleeve, and a plurality of first matching holes are formed in the grinding sleeve in a penetrating mode. By the adoption of the scheme, the stirring device for preparing the polishing agent has the advantages that blocky substances needing to be added into the tank body and stirred with the polishing agent are placed into the grinding cavity of the grinding sleeve, and at the moment, the stirring shaft is started to drive the blades to rotate to grind the blocky substances, so that the blocky substances and the polishing agent are stirred more sufficiently.

Description

Technical Field

[0001] The utility model relates to a stirring device for preparing a polishing agent. Background Art

[0002] Polishing agent is a chemical agent used to improve the gloss and smoothness of the surface of an object. It is widely used in the surface treatment of various materials such as metal, wood, stone, plastic, glass, etc. to remove scratches, blemishes and oxide layers on the surface, making the surface smoother and brighter.

[0003] During the preparation of polishing agents, some powdered nano-abrasives, surfactants, thickeners and dispersants are usually added to mix and blend the polishing agents with them to improve the gloss of the polishing agents. Before adding them, it is necessary to determine whether there is any agglomeration. If there is agglomeration, it needs to be sieved to make the obtained substance into fine powder, and then added to the stirring device. The newly added sieving and grinding steps will prolong the time required for stirring and preparing the polishing agent, thereby causing inconvenience in use.

[0004] Therefore, how to grind the agglomerated material while stirring the various components in the polishing agent has become an urgent problem to be solved by those skilled in the art. Summary of the Invention

[0005] In view of the shortcomings of the existing technology, the purpose of the present invention is to provide a stirring device for preparing polishing agent, which is composed of a block material required to be added to a tank body and stirred with a polishing agent, and a grinding chamber of a grinding sleeve. At this time, the stirring shaft is started to drive the blade to rotate to grind the block material so that it can be stirred with the polishing agent more fully.

[0006] To ach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the present invention provides the following technical solution: it includes a tank body, a cover body, a stirring shaft rotatably installed in the tank body, and a motor, the motor is linked to the stirring shaft and is detachably connected to the stirring shaft, the stirring shaft and the length direction of the tank body both extend up and down, a stirring chamber is provided in the tank body, and also includes a grinding sleeve located above the stirring chamber, the grinding sleeve includes a grinding chamber, a splash-proof cover is detachably installed on the grinding sleeve, the stirring shaft includes a stirring section and a grinding section in which the grinding sleeve is inserted, a stirring paddle is fixedly installed on the stirring section, a blade is fixedly installed on the grinding section and the blade is located in the grinding sleeve, and a plurality of first matching holes are provided on the grinding sleeve.

[0007] The utility model is further configured as follows: it also includes a placement sleeve fixedly connected to the grinding sleeve, the circumference of the placement sleeve is against the inner wall of the tank body, the placement sleeve is detachably connected to the tank body, and the placement sleeve is provided with a second matching hole corresponding to each first matching hole, one end of each second matching hole is connected to the first matching hole and the other end is connected to the stirring chamber.

[0008] The utility model is further configured such that: each first matching hole is configured to be expanded from the inside toward the outside.

[0009] The utility model is further configured as follows: it also includes a plurality of connecting bolts, the placement sleeve includes a mounting plate at the top, the bottom surface of the mounting plate is against the top surface of the tank body, the mounting plate is provided with circumferentially spaced insertion holes with the same number as the connecting bolts, and the tank body is provided with screw holes corresponding to each insertion hole that match the corresponding connecting bolt thread.

[0010] The present invention is further configured as follows: a plurality of connecting plugs are provided on the top of the grinding sleeve in a circumferentially protruding manner; the splash-proof cover is made of a deformable material and a connecting slot is provided corresponding to each connecting plug.

[0011] The present invention is further configured such that: each of the connecting plugs is arranged in a stepped shape with a width at the top and a narrowness at the bottom; each of the connecting plugs includes an outer alignment surface; and each alignment surface is arranged to be inclined from the inside to the outside from the top to the bottom.

[0012] The utility model is further configured as follows: the stirring paddle includes blades arranged at intervals along the circumference of the stirring section and guide plates located between each blade and the stirring section, and each guide plate is arranged to be inclined from top to bottom and from inside to outside.

[0013] By adopting the above technical solution, since the grinding sleeve is located above the stirring chamber, before the polishing agent and other added substances need to be stirred to fully mix them, the splash-proof cover can be removed and the powdered substance can be placed in the grinding chamber of the grinding sleeve. Then the splash-proof cover is covered and the motor is placed above the grinding sleeve to complete the connection with the stirring shaft. At this time, when the cover is installed and the motor is started to drive the stirring shaft to rotate, the stirring paddle on the stirring section and the blade on the grinding section can rotate synchronously. At this time, as the blade rotates, the block-like substance in the grinding chamber can be crushed by the action of the blade and then separated from the grinding sleeve through each first matching hole and enter the stirring chamber to be fully mixed with the polishing agent. [0028] like Figures 1-6 As shown, the utility model discloses a stirring device for preparing polishing agent, comprising a tank body 1, a cover body 2 detachable from the tank body 1 by means of magnetism, thread, etc., a stirring shaft 3 rotatably mounted in the tank body 1, and a motor 4 located above the cover body 2, wherein the motor 4 is linked with the stirring shaft 3 and is detachably connected to the stirring shaft 3 by means of a key connection, etc., wherein the stirring shaft 3 and the length direction of the tank body 1 are both extended vertically, and after the nano-abrasive, surfactant, thickener and dispersant required to be mixed with the polishing agent are loaded into the tank body 1, At this time, the motor 4 can drive the stirring shaft 3 to rotate so that the polishing agent and other substances in the tank body 1 can be fully mixed and reacted (this is the existing technology and will not be elaborated here). The tank body 1 is provided with a stirring chamber 11, and also includes a grinding sleeve 5 located above the stirring chamber 11. The grinding sleeve 5 includes a grinding chamber 51. The grinding sleeve 5 is detachably mounted with a splash-proof cover 52 by means of buckling, bolts, etc. The stirring shaft 3 includes a stirring section 31 and a grinding section 32 located in which the grinding sleeve 5 is inserted. The stirring paddle 311 is fixedly mounted on the segment 31 by welding, integral molding, etc., and the blade 321 is fixedly mounted on the grinding segment 32 by bolts, etc. and the blade 321 is located in the grinding sleeve 5. The grinding sleeve 5 is provided with a plurality of first matching holes 53 therethrough. Since the grinding sleeve 5 is located above the stirring chamber 11, before the polishing agent and other substances to be added need to be stirred and fully mixed, the splash cover 52 can be removed and the powdered substance can be placed in the grinding chamber 51 of the grinding sleeve 5. , then cover the splash-proof cover 52 and place the motor 4 above the grinding sleeve 5 to complete the connection with the stirring shaft 3. At this time, when the cover body 2 is installed and the motor 4 is started to drive the stirring shaft 3 to rotate, the stirring paddle 311 on the stirring section 31 and the blade 321 on the grinding section 32 can rotate synchronously. At this time, as the blade 321 rotates, the block-shaped material in the grinding chamber 51 can be crushed by the blade 321 and then separated from the grinding sleeve 5 through the first matching holes 53 and enter the stirring chamber 11 to be fully mixed with the polishing agent.

[0029] Among them, it also includes a placement sleeve 6 fixedly connected to the grinding sleeve 5, the circumference of the placement sleeve 6 is against the inner wall of the tank body 1, and the placement sleeve 6 and the tank body 1 are detachably connected by magnetic attraction, snap-fitting, etc., and the placement sleeve 6 is provided with a second matching hole 61 corresponding to each first matching hole 53, one end of each second matching hole 61 is communicated with the first matching hole 53 and the other end is communicated with the stirring chamber 11. Since the placement sleeve 6 is fixedly connected to the grinding sleeve 5, it will prevent the sleeve from being installed in the tank body 1. At this time, since the circumference of the placement sleeve 6 will be against the inner wall of the tank body 1, the radial position of the grinding sleeve 5 can be determined by installing the placement sleeve 6 into the tank body 1. In order to make the placement sleeve 6 detachably connected to the tank body 1, after the connection between the placement sleeve 6 and the tank body 1 is completed, the axial position of the grinding sleeve 5 can be determined, and since the placement sleeve 6 is provided with a second matching hole 61 corresponding to each first matching hole 53, after the assembly of the placement sleeve 6 and the tank body 1 is completed, the rotating blade 321 can break up the block material and move it through the first matching holes 53 toward the second matching holes 61 and enter the stirring chamber 11, and the polishing agent can move directly toward the stirring chamber 11 through the second matching holes 61, and if there are impurities in the polishing agent, it cannot flow downward due to the action of the second matching holes 61 and can remain in the placement sleeve 6.

[0030] Preferably, each first matching hole 53 is flared from the inside out. Since each first matching hole 53 is flared from the inside out, that is, the outer diameter of each first matching hole 53 is larger than the inner diameter, when the abrasive, surfactant, thickener and dispersant are placed into the grinding sleeve 5, it is difficult for the abrasive and other materials to pass through the inner side of each first matching hole 53, that is, the side with the smallest diameter. After the stirring shaft 3 drives the blade 321 to rotate and the material in the grinding sleeve 5 is broken, the volume of the material in the grinding sleeve 5 becomes smaller. If the volume is smaller than the innermost diameter of the first matching hole 53, it can pass through the first matching holes 53 and be separated from the grinding sleeve 5, thereby entering the stirring chamber 11 to mix with the polishing agent. Therefore, the setting of each first matching hole 53 enables the abrasive to be stably located in the grinding sleeve 5 and will not fall directly into the stirring chamber 11.

[0031] Among them, it also includes a number of connecting bolts (not shown in the figure), the placement sleeve 6 includes a mounting plate 62 at the top, the bottom surface of the mounting plate 62 is against the top surface of the tank body 1, the mounting plate 62 is provided with the same number of sockets 621 as the connecting bolts along the circumferential interval, and the tank body 1 is provided with screw holes 12 corresponding to the respective sockets 621 that are threadedly matched with the corresponding connecting bolts. Therefore, during the assembly process, when the bottom of the mounting plate 62 is against the top surface of the tank body 1, the axial position of the placement sleeve 6 relative to the tank body 1 is confirmed. The positioning of the placing sleeve 6 and the tank body 1 can be completed by inserting each connecting bolt into the socket 621 and threadedly engaging with the corresponding screw hole 12, so that the placing sleeve 6 is stably located on the tank body 1. At the same time, the positioning of the grinding sleeve 5 and the tank body 1 is completed. When the grinding sleeve 5 and the placing sleeve 6 need to be removed from the tank body 1 for cleaning, each connecting bolt can be removed from between the mounting plate 62 and the tank body 1 by rotating the connecting bolt counterclockwise, thereby completing the separation of the placing sleeve 6 and the tank body 1.

[0032] In addition, a plurality of connecting plugs 54 are circumferentially protruding from the top of the grinding sleeve 5, and the splash-proof cover 52 is made of a deformable material such as rubber and a connecting slot 521 is provided corresponding to each connecting plug 54. After the material to be ground is placed in the grinding sleeve 5, due to the presence of the splash-proof cover 52, the material in the grinding sleeve 5 will not splash out beyond the splash-proof cover 52 during the rotation of the stirring shaft 3, and irrelevant personnel cannot touch the splash-proof cover 52, so that the splash-proof cover 52 can be stably located on the grinding sleeve 5. At the same time, since the grinding sleeve 5 is circumferentially provided with connecting plugs 54, when the splash-proof cover 52 is installed on the top of the grinding sleeve 5, it is necessary to forcibly bend the splash-proof cover 52 so that the connecting slots 521 on the splash-proof cover 52 can cooperate with the corresponding connecting plugs 54, so that the splash-proof cover 52 can be stably located on the grinding sleeve 5.

[0033] Preferably, each of the connecting plugs 54 is arranged in a stepped shape that is wide at the top and narrow at the bottom, and each of the connecting plugs 54 includes an outer alignment surface 541, and each alignment surface 541 is inclined from the inside to the outside from the top to the bottom. Since each alignment surface 541 is inclined from the inside to the outside from the top to the bottom, when the splash cover 52 is bent so that each of the connecting plugs 54 can be inserted into the corresponding connecting slot 521, the outermost side of each connecting plug 54 is the first to enter the connecting slot 521, and the outer alignment surface 541 of each connecting plug 54 is inclined, so that each connecting plug 54 can fall into the corresponding connecting slot 521 more smoothly, so that the splash cover 52 is stably located on the grinding sleeve 5.

[0034] In addition, the stirring paddle 311 includes blades 3111 arranged at intervals along the circumference of the stirring section 31 and guide plates 3112 located between each blade 3111 and the stirring section 31, and each guide plate 3112 is inclined from top to bottom and from inside to outside. 1. The guide plates 3112 located between each blade 3111 and the stirring section 31 can improve the overall strength of the stirring paddle 311, thereby reducing the possibility of damage to the stirring paddle 311 during the process of starting the motor 4 to drive the stirring shaft 3 to rotate at high speed; 2. Since each guide plate 3112 is inclined, when the motor 4 drives the stirring shaft to rotate and thus causes the stirring paddle 311 to rotate, the material in contact with each guide plate 3112 can fall along the inclined direction of the guide plate 3112, thereby reducing the accumulation on the guide plate 3112.
